jasně...děkuji za pomoc
Příspěvky odeslané z IP adresy 188.120.217.–
jo to jo, dal jsem to sem jen jako příklad, možná kvůli tomu to bylo zavádějící
Jo už tomu rozumím. Už mi to ukládá. Ještě bych se chtěl zeptat jak to uložím jen jednou? Ted mi to ukládá do celého pole.. Děkuji.
No mám na mysli že pokud najde prázdnou hodnotu tak přiřadí proměnou, aby nedocházelo k přepisování
Zdravím, potřeboval bych poradit, jak postupně přidávat hodnoty do pole. Mám to takhle ale nějak to nejede.
float pole [5];
float a,c,d;
cin >> a;
cin >> c;
d=(a/c);
for (int i=0; i<6; i++)
if(pole[i] == "")
{
pole[i] = d;
cout << pole[i]<<endl;
}
Všem děkuji za pomoc.
Když tam budou zuby tak to nevadí. Vím že nastavím hodnatu na "", ale nevím jak to napsat.
Děkuji vyřešeno. Poslední dotaz. Jak to jmeno smažu? Děkuji.
cout << " vymazte slovo ";
cin >> b;
for (int i=0; i<100; i++)
if(a[i] == b)
//tak vymaž jmeno
Moc děkuju všem za rady. Já už to mam celé napsané pomocí těch polí. Už mi jde i to přidávání jmen, ale vyplní mi to celé pole. Jak udělám, aby se to napsalo pouze jednou?
cout << " Napiste jmeno ";
cin >> b;
for (int i=0; i<100; i++)
if(c[i] == "") {
c[i]=b;
}
Zdravím potřeboval bych poradit s přidávání, vyhledáváním a mazáním slov v poli (je to adresář jmen). Mám udělané dvě pole. Jedno na jména a jedno na přijmení. Pustím program zadám jméno, ale nevím pomocí čeho ho mám uložit do pole. V pole už jména jsou takže aby se to uložilo k nim. To samé s mazáním.
Vyhledávání mám takhle
#include <iostream>
#include <string>
using namespace std;
int main( ){
int x;
string b;
string a[100]={"honza", "pepa"};
string s[100]={"novak", "novotny"};
cout << "Napiste hledane slovo ";
cin >> b;
for(x=0; x<1; x++)
if (b==a[x])
cout << a[x] <<endl;
else if (b==s[x])
cout << s[x] << endl;
else
cout<< "Hledane slovo neni v adresari"<< endl;
return(0);
}
U vyhledávání bych chtěl abych dal třeba jen Honza a ono mi to vypíše Honza Novak. Dejme tomu že žádné jmeno tam nebude dvakrát. Jen dodám že programuji chvilku. Děkuji.
Dobrý den potřebuji realizovat 8 anal. výstupů s pwm nejlépe u procesoru ATMEGA 8515, on sám má pouze 2 PWM. Programuji v Bascomu, 2 pwm obsloužit není problém, ale jak vyřešit 8 ??? Vim že to musí nějak jít vymyslet, před časem jsem stavěl převodník DMX /Analog a funguje výborně, jen jsem nepsal program :-(. Děkuji za každou odpověď, nebo zdrojáček. Zdeněk